2nd International Conference on Dismantling of Obsolete Vessels 15-16th September 2008, Glasgow

The conference aims to explore the recent trends in ship dismantling and recycling to develop strategies and processes to set up an innovative ship-dismantling site in European Union, and discuss the issues related to high demand for ship recycling at the end of this decade towards the adoption of new international regulations. Contributions are invited on topics such as ship dismantling processes, optimization of ship breaking facilities, environmental issues, cost, decision support systems for the industry and case studies.

INDUSTRY FACTS

The most recent industry statistics are from 2006 and can be viewed in the Community of European Shipyards Associations yearbook 2006 - 2007.

In 2006, 5500 people in the UK were employed in ship maintenance, repair, conversion and new building.

The main market in the UK is for ship maintenance, repair and conversion, with a limited number of large vessels being built in the UK each year. Commercial build orders are difficult to win outside the super yacht and leisure boat industry.
